This is in C#. I need help with these two excercises. I tried doing it, but nothing I did works Chapter 13 Programming Exercise 5: Write a program that stores 50 random numbers in a file. The random numbers should be positive with the largest value being 1000. Store five numbers per line and 10 different lines. Use the Random class to generate the values. Include appropriate exception-handling techniques in your solution. Chapter 13 Programming Exercise 6: Write a program that retrieves the values stored in a text file. The file should contain 10 different rows of data with five values per line. Display the largest and smallest value from each line. Include appropriate exception-handling techniques in your solution. Hint: If you completed Programming Exercise #5, use the text file created by that exercise.
